Anxiety is supposed to be an ally. It is a primal emotional experience that is supposed to help you avoid danger. It forecasts a potential future, but in the modern world, that future may not exist. The dirty trick of anxiety is often the worrying about worrying about worrying about worrying about worry. Stopping the cycle through increased understanding of the biological systems involved in anxiety and learning how to change the bodies reactions begins the process of turning anxiety back into an ally instead of an enemy you have to fight.

Everyone experiences anxiety at some point, but for some the anxiety is so frequent or intense that it interferes with their lives or even triggers panic attacks. I use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) to help my clients get a sense of control over their own anxiety. We collaborate to learn skills to reduce the frequency or intensity of the anxious feelings, to tolerate the anxiety when it does occur so they can still function through it, and to practice habits that reduce stress and improve general mental health.

Glenn Heights is a city that is located in multiple counties- Ellis County and Dallas County in Texas. It has a land area of 7.21 square miles and a water area of 0.00 square miles.  The population of Glenn Heights is 12,042 people with 3,836 households and a median annual income of $62,404. .
